WebNov 1, 2024 · Metacarpal bones ( ossa metacarpi) are the bones that support the palm of the hand. Each consists of a elongated body (shaft), cuboid base, and convex head. The bases articulate with the distal row of the carpus and the heads articulate with the proximal phalanges. Each bone is assigned a number from 1 to 5, starting on the lateral side …
